_Exobasidium_ leaf and fruit spot has been reported from numerous locations in North Carolina this year [2019]. The disease, caused by the fungus _Exobasidium maculosum_, is visible now on leaves, but will also infect berries. On leaves, spots are pale green on the upper surface but pure white below, with a thin, dense layer of fungal growth on the underside of the leaf [which] can also occur on infected berries.
